The Gold Mohair Pupa is like the Faux Killer Bug another great subsurface fly that has produced well for me both in lakes and in rivers. It is a good imitation of the rising caddis pupae. Feel free to add extra weight by wrapping copper or lead wire to the hook shank if you want the fly to go deeper.
Gold Mohair Pupa
Hook: Curved nymph hook, size 10 to 16
Weight: Coffee colored tungsten bead head from Picar
Thread: Black
Abdomen: UNI Mohair yarn in the color Gold made into dubbing
Ribbing: Dark mahogany colored polyester sewing thread
Thorax: Peacock herl
Legs: Dark partridge fibers
